Afgoo
Afgoo (also known as Afgooey or Afghan Goo) is a legendary 80% indica-dominant strain delivering deeply earthy, piney, skunky aromas and a high that moves from euphoric uplift to profound full-body relaxation. With THC levels up to 30% and a myrcene-dominant terpene profile, it's a go-to for stress relief, pain management, and sleep support — best enjoyed as an evening ritual.

Afgoo: The Sticky Indica Legend
If you're searching for a strain that wraps you in a warm, resinous embrace and melts the day's stress into the couch cushions, Afgoo — also known as Afgooey, Afghan Goo, or Af-Gooey — is a name that deserves serious attention. This 80% indica-dominant hybrid has earned its reputation over decades as one of the most reliable, deeply sedating, and aromatically complex strains in the cannabis world. With THC levels ranging from 16% to a formidable 30%, Afgoo is a strain that commands respect whether you're a seasoned consumer or a curious newcomer.
🧬 Genetic Heritage & Lineage
Afgoo's exact lineage carries some mystery, as is common with many classic clone-only strains that circulated through the West Coast cannabis underground beginning in the 2000s. Most accounts trace its roots to Afghani landrace genetics, one of the oldest and most revered cannabis gene pools in the world, crossed with Maui Haze — a sativa influence that adds a subtle cerebral uplift to what would otherwise be a purely sedating indica. This combination results in a profile that leans heavily toward the body while still delivering moments of euphoria and creative thought. The strain's widespread popularity across California dispensaries helped cement its status as a staple of West Coast cannabis culture.
👃 Terpene Profile & Aromatics
Afgoo's aromatic identity is defined by a rich, multi-layered terpene profile that hits you before the first puff:
- Myrcene (0.60%) — The dominant terpene, responsible for the deeply earthy, musky base note and the pronounced sedating body effects. Myrcene is the engine behind Afgoo's signature couch-lock.
- Beta-Caryophyllene (0.35%) — Adds spicy, peppery warmth and functions as a CB2 receptor agonist, contributing to its notable pain-relieving and anti-inflammatory properties.
- Alpha-Pinene (0.20%) — Introduces a fresh, forest-floor pine sharpness that cuts through the earthiness and adds a touch of mental alertness.
- Limonene (0.175%) — Provides bright citrus uplift, contributing to mood elevation and the strain's euphoric edge.
- Humulene (0.125%) — Adds a dry, herbal, woody depth while supporting anti-inflammatory effects.
- Linalool (0.075%) — A subtle floral, lavender calm that rounds out the profile and deepens the relaxation.
The overall aroma is pungent, earthy, and deeply skunky with unmistakable pine resin, sweet herbal undertones, and faint citrus brightness dancing at the edges.
👅 Flavor Experience
On the inhale, you'll be greeted by rich, damp earth and fresh pine — like a walk through an ancient forest after rain. The mid-palate opens up with spicy herbal notes and a subtle sweetness that balances the skunkiness beautifully. On the exhale, woody, slightly citrusy tones linger on the tongue, leaving an aftertaste that is resinous, earthy, and deeply satisfying. The full flavor journey is complex without being overwhelming — familiar yet deeply interesting.
🎯 Effects & Experience
Onset arrives within minutes — a warm euphoric wave sweeps through the mind, lifting mood and gently dissolving anxiety. You'll notice a creative, slightly uplifted mental state in the first 15-30 minutes before the indica genetics take over. As the high deepens, expect profound full-body relaxation, muscle release, and a comfortable heaviness that settles into your limbs. The peak is characterized by happy, content sedation — not an overwhelming knockout but a deeply comfortable, blissful calm. As the session winds down, sleepiness tends to creep in naturally, making this an ideal evening companion.

👁️ Visual Characteristics
Afgoo buds are dense, chunky, and dripping with resin. You'll notice deep forest greens, occasionally accented by subtle olive and moss tones, blanketed in a thick coating of frosty white trichomes that reflect the strain's potency visually. Rust-colored to amber pistils curl and twist through the dense bud structure, providing a striking contrast against the dark greens.

⚠️ Consumer Considerations
Afgoo is best suited for intermediate to experienced consumers due to its potentially high THC content (up to 30%). Novices should start with very small amounts and allow ample time to assess effects before redosing. Common side effects include dry mouth, dry eyes, occasional dizziness, and at high doses, potential paranoia.
